    Five stars not because they are the best supermarket in the world but this is the nicest Aldi I have been to this far. This place feels more spacious but has a Whole Foods type of feel. There is some thought out into making the place nice, high quality zoomed in pictures of fruits/vegetables decors on the walls etc. you know what I mean. Everything else about unique about Aldi still here, same aisle set up, cheaper prices, some organic options, etc. all I'm saying is this place feels like a nicer Aldi. Better shopping experience than other ones I've been to. Will definitely come back again!
